Introduction
Syracuse University, founded in 1870 and located in Syracuse, New York, is a prestigious private research university known for its vibrant campus life, innovative programs, and strong emphasis on professional preparation. Syracuse combines academic excellence with experiential learning, providing students with hands-on opportunities through internships, research, and global study programs. Its diverse community and wide range of resources make it a hub for personal and academic growth.
